there is a screw in the window track under the seal at the top of the door, atleast that is the way mine was.
Thank you very much.

Quote:
Originally Posted by wood1 View Post
Don't pry them.. Yes, there are screws in them as MIKESAD50 said. I've had them with 1 at the top and up to 4 total around the trim under seal area.
Usually at least 1 at top around where they clip together.
